The Best Language Learning Resources for Mastering a New Language

Online Courses

One of the most effective ways to learn a new language is through online courses. With the growing popularity of e-learning platforms, there are countless options available that cater to different learning styles and levels of proficiency.

Popular online language learning platforms such as Duolingo, Babbel, and Rosetta Stone offer comprehensive courses that cover all aspects of language learning, including grammar, vocabulary, listening, speaking, and writing skills. These platforms often use gamification techniques to make the learning process more engaging and interactive. They also provide progress tracking and personalized feedback to help learners stay motivated and monitor their progress.

Language Exchange Programs

Language exchange programs provide a unique opportunity for language learners to practice their skills with native speakers. These programs typically pair learners with someone who speaks the language they want to learn, and in return, the learner helps their partner practice their target language.

Websites and apps like Tandem and HelloTalk facilitate language exchanges by connecting learners from different countries. Through video calls, voice messages, or text chats, language learners can improve their speaking and comprehension skills while gaining cultural insights from their language exchange partner. Language exchange programs provide an immersive learning experience and allow learners to practice in a real-life context, which is essential for language fluency.

Language Learning Apps

In addition to online courses, language learning apps have become increasingly popular due to their convenience and accessibility. Apps like Memrise, Pimsleur, and FluentU offer a wide range of language learning resources that can be accessed anytime, anywhere.

These apps often incorporate interactive exercises, flashcards, and quizzes to help learners memorize vocabulary and grammar rules. Some apps even use AI technology to provide personalized learning recommendations based on the learner’s progress and areas that need improvement.

Language Learning Communities

Joining language learning communities can greatly enhance the language learning experience. These communities bring together learners from all over the world who share a common goal of mastering a new language.

Online forums like Reddit’s language learning subreddits, language learning Facebook groups, and language learning forums like WordReference provide a platform for learners to ask questions, share resources, and engage in discussions with fellow language enthusiasts and native speakers.

Furthermore, language learning communities often organize language exchange meetups, language challenges, and virtual study groups, allowing learners to practice their skills in a supportive and collaborative environment.

Authentic Resources

When learning a new language, it’s important to expose oneself to authentic resources such as books, movies, podcasts, and music in the target language.

Reading books in the original language helps improve vocabulary, grammar, and reading comprehension skills. Starting with children’s books and gradually progressing to more complex texts can make the process more manageable and enjoyable.

Watching movies or TV shows in the target language with subtitles can improve listening skills and help learners pick up colloquial expressions and cultural nuances. Listening to podcasts or music in the target language enhances pronunciation and expands vocabulary. Apps like Netflix, Spotify, and Podbean offer a wide range of content in different languages.

Language Learning Tools

Language learning tools can be a valuable addition to one’s language learning journey. These tools range from online dictionaries and translation apps to flashcard applications and pronunciation guides.

Online dictionaries like Oxford Dictionaries and Merriam-Webster provide comprehensive and accurate definitions, synonyms, and example sentences. Translation apps like Google Translate and Yandex Translate can be used for quick translations and to check understanding.

Flashcard applications like Anki and Quizlet allow users to create personalized flashcards to memorize vocabulary, verb conjugations, and other language components. Pronunciation guides like Forvo and HowToPronounce provide audio recordings of native speakers pronouncing words and phrases correctly. For a well-rounded understanding of the topic, be sure to visit the suggested external source. You’ll find plenty of extra information and a fresh perspective. learn Italian, enhance your educational journey!

By incorporating these language learning resources into one’s language learning routine, learners can effectively improve their language skills and achieve fluency in their target language.

